The design of the Kia EV5 production model has supposedly been revealed. Pictures shared by media outlet Autohome have allegedly been leaked by the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ology. Assuming the images are authentic, as expected, the design is similar to the concept first revealed in March.
The Kia EV5 has a sculpted design featuring a Digital Tiger Face and an aerodynamic roof spoiler. Two versions of the new model are expected; a standard version and a long-range model with over 600 km (~372 miles) range. The SUV will feature a 214 hp motor, delivering up to 310 Nm torque. According to Autohome, the car will measure 4,615 x 1,875 x 1,715 mm (~182 x 74 x 68-in) and have a 2,750 mm (~108 in) wheelbase.
Reports earlier this month suggest that the Kia EV5 production model will be revealed at the Chengdu Motor Show starting August 25. The same post claimed that the car would retail for 50 million won (~US$39,000), a competitive price in markets like the US. The vehicle is expected to be available to order in China this November; it remains unclear when the e-SUV could launch in other markets.
